Giovanni Battista Pergolesi died in 1736 at the tragically young age of 26. This meditation on the suffering of Mary as she stands at the foot of the cross is profoundly moving and his most celebrated sacred work. Lera Auerbach is one of the most widely performed composers of the new generation. 'Sogno di Stabat Mater' (2005) is a reworking of some of Pergolesi's themes, seen through a contemporary lens and featuring a solo violin and viola. Joyful Concerti Grossi by Handel and Corelli complete the programme.
Originally from London, Ontario, Christopher Jones read music at McGill University and later studied at the RNCM. He is the leader of the Gildas Quartet, which has performed to critical acclaim at major venues including the Wigmore Hall and Purcell Room and live on BBC Radio 3.
